The biggest upsets of the QF were the defeats of MA/HS seeded 1 and world number 2 to the unseeded pair of RonaldAlexander/Selvanus Geh 21-8, 19-21, 18-21 in 34 minutes and Lindaweni Fanetri seeded 1 to the unseeded Yao Xue 19-21, 16-21. The four Indonesian MS players, SDK, TS (world number 7 as of 26/9/2013), SS and DHR, all made it to the SF and Indonesia are thus assured of the MS title and the only question is who will prevail. Will it be the old guns (SDK/SS) or the young ones (TS/DHR)?
